European Bachelor's in Human Resources
🎓 European Bachelor's in Human Resources
Level: EQF 6 | Credits: 60 ECTS | Duration: 1 year
Certified by: FEDE – Fédération Européenne des Écoles
Format: Full-time or Work-study (including 12-week internship)
🎯 Learning Outcomes
Graduates will be able to:
• Help define and implement HR strategy
• Manage personnel administration and payroll
• Apply the organisation's recruitment and training policies
• Design skills development tools and HR management systems
• Oversee social relations, CSR, and workplace sustainability
• Ensure HR compliance and performance evaluation
• Promote inclusion, diversity, and disability accessibility
• Support and advise employees and managers on HR matters

📚 Programme Content
1. Managing Human Resources
• Legal and regulatory monitoring
• Payroll management and compliance
• HR performance monitoring and tools
2. Well-being at Work & Social Dialogue
• Health, safety, and working conditions
• Managing workplace well-being
• Facilitating social dialogue
3. Optimising Attractiveness & Recruitment
• HR marketing and employer branding
• Recruitment processes
• Onboarding and integration
4. Developing a Learning Organisation
• Corporate training systems
• Career and job path management
• Skills development planning

💼 Professional Assignment (≥12 weeks)
• Internship, apprenticeship, or salaried employment
• Typically 4 days per week in-company for work-study format
• Completion of a professional report and oral defence
📝 Assessment Methods
• Continuous assessment
• Case Study (6 hours)
• Activity report and professional support (30 min)
• Reading comprehension (1 hour)
• Listening comprehension (45 min)
• CCE (Company Skills Certificate) quiz (1h20)
🏛️ Examination & Certification Process
• Supervised by the FEDE
• Anonymity and confidentiality guaranteed
• Evaluation and correction by certified examiners
• Issuance of:
European Bachelor's Diploma in Human Resources
Diploma Supplement
Modern Language Certificate
Company Skills Certificate (CCE)
• Fully recognised in the European Higher Education Area
• Compliant with EQF Level 6
